Ex Cathedra / Jeffrey Skidmore
'Shared Ground' is a set of works by the British composer Alec Roth, featuring several poems and sung texts by the Indian writer Vikram Seth. The title piece of the same name is inspired by Seth's poetry following a decision to buy and live in the Old Rectory in Bemerton - the former home of the 17th-century poet and priest George Herbert. Other works on the disc expand this idea of a shared home or dwelling, with 'Earthrise' - collection the reflections of Apollo astronauts on viewing the planet from orbit - and 'Hymn to Gaia'.
This disc follows the 2008 release of Roth's Songs in Time of War (SIGCD124), featuring the tenor Mark Padmore with Philippe Honoré, Alison Nichols (harp) and Morgan Szymanski (guitar):
